MANUFACTURING TECH I - 3rd Shift

McCormick & Company · Geneva, IL · 3 days ago
AnalystF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Set up and operate all pieces of the filling packaging equipment as well as perform hand-filling tasks
  • Operate a small Spray Dryer
  • Understand and follow all packaging instructions on production cards and daily schedule (i.e. Weights, label requirements, formula integrity, machine number, etc.)
  • Keep accurate production records, report information daily and accurate reporting
  • Inspect in-process goods for proper weights, labeling, packaging, pallet configuration, correct and/or report defects
  • Perform sanitation duties, perform proper housekeeping, and adhere to safety and GMP procedures
  • Help maintain equipment, report all machinery breakdowns or problems, and resolve basic mechanical issues
  • Perform all retain procedures
  • Absorb and assist in making basic, small blends, and emulsions
  • Perform sampling procedures per specifications
  • Operate fork truck in a safe manner
  • Perform changeovers and wash downs (including chemical, allergen, and kosher) of equipment
  • Participate in team/department meetings, offering suggestions where warranted
  • Responsible for disposal of trash and operating compactor

Requirements

  • Ability to use logical thinking in performing multiple duties, often working on different projects at the same time
  • Ability to memorize various policies and procedures
  • Ability to know when to go to higher level for a decision
  • Ability to read and interpret various formula sheets, printed/written materials, and computer screens
  • Ability to distinguish colors
  • Ability to perform basic math functions; must be able to write legibly
  • Ability to lift and carry pails of liquids (50 lbs), move containers over 50 lbs., hand roll 600 lb drums
  • Ability to climb ladders/stairs and bend/stoop to work around equipment
  • Ability to operate hand tools, high-pressure water hoses, and enter information onto a computer (touch-screen/keyboard)
  • Ability to work a full shift plus daily overtime (often on short notice) and on weekends, plus have flexibility to work other shifts or longer shifts (10-12 hours)
  • Fork truck license required or ability to become fork truck certified through McCormick and Company
  • Ability to work in a team-based environment
  • Ability to wear a PAPR/positive pressure respirator and to be physically able to complete annual pulmonary function monitoring and testing
